R.I. Gen. Laws § 6A-8-113



§ 6A-8-113.  Statute of frauds inapplicable.

A contract or modification of a contract for the sale or purchase of a security is enforceable whether or not there is a writing signed or record authenticated by a party against whom enforcement is sought, even if the contract or modification is not capable of performance within one year of its making.

History of Section.
P.L. 2000, ch. 182, § 5; P.L. 2000, ch. 420, § 5.
